Question
If $A = \left[ {\begin{array}{*{20}{c}}3&5\\2&0\end{array}} \right]$ and $B = \left[ {\begin{array}{*{20}{c}}1&{17}\\0&{ - 10}\end{array}} \right]$ then $|AB|$ is equal to

Answer

b
(b) Since $A$ and $ B $ are square matrix 

$\therefore $$|AB|\, = |A||B|$; $|A|\, = - 10;|B| = - 10$

$\therefore $$|AB|\, = 100$.
